]> granicus.if.org Git - php/commitdiff
Reorder fields for most often access pattern
authorDmitry Stogov <dmitry@zend.com>
Mon, 17 Nov 2014 11:06:50 +0000 (14:06 +0300)
committerDmitry Stogov <dmitry@zend.com>
Mon, 17 Nov 2014 11:06:50 +0000 (14:06 +0300)
Zend/zend_types.h

index 383f77caa414fa5600c08606e24d4f0cd7f3456b..b07a62668cd99d15bdff9bc49639cc12e298257b 100644 (file)
@@ -145,9 +145,9 @@ struct _zend_string {
 };
 
 typedef struct _Bucket {
+       zval              val;
        zend_ulong        h;                /* hash value (or numeric index)   */
        zend_string      *key;              /* string key or NULL for numerics */
-       zval              val;
 } Bucket;
 
 typedef struct _HashTable {